Domande taggate «glob»

glob, più propriamente chiamati [shell] pattern, e conosciuti anche come espressioni jolly, sono istanze di un linguaggio di pattern-matching usato in molti, specialmente. Shell tipo POSIX, per abbinare nomi di file e stringhe: ad esempio, `* .c` è un glob per i file sorgente C e corrisponde a qualsiasi file il cui suffisso (estensione) è` .c`.

25
Come usare glob () per trovare i file in modo ricorsivo?
Questo è quello che ho: glob(os.path.join('src','*.c')) ma voglio cercare nelle sottocartelle di src. Qualcosa del genere funzionerebbe: glob(os.path.join('src','*.c')) glob(os.path.join('src','*','*.c')) glob(os.path.join('src','*','*','*.c')) glob(os.path.join('src','*','*','*','*.c')) Ma questo è ovviamente limitato e goffo.






19
Verifica se un glob ha delle corrispondenze in bash
Se voglio verificare l'esistenza di un singolo file, posso provarlo usando test -e filenameo [ -e filename ]. Supponiamo di avere un glob e voglio sapere se esistono file i cui nomi corrispondono al glob. Il glob può abbinare 0 file (nel qual caso non devo fare nulla) oppure può …
223 bash  glob 

11
Aggiungi ricorsivamente file per modello
Come faccio ad aggiungere in modo ricorsivo i file tramite un pattern (o glob) situato in directory diverse? Ad esempio, vorrei aggiungere A/B/C/foo.javae D/E/F/bar.java(e diversi altri file java) con un solo comando: git add '*.java' Sfortunatamente, ciò non funziona come previsto.
172 git  glob  filepattern 

14
Sposta tutti i file tranne uno
Come posso spostare tutti i file tranne uno? Sto cercando qualcosa come: 'mv ~/Linux/Old/!Tux.png ~/Linux/New/' dove sposto roba vecchia in nuova roba -cartella tranne Tux.png. ! -sign rappresenta una negazione. C'è qualche strumento per il lavoro?
155 linux  bash  glob 

30
Python glob più tipi di file
Esiste un modo migliore per utilizzare glob.glob in Python per ottenere un elenco di più tipi di file come .txt, .mdown e .markdown? In questo momento ho qualcosa del genere: projectFiles1 = glob.glob( os.path.join(projectDir, '*.txt') ) projectFiles2 = glob.glob( os.path.join(projectDir, '*.mdown') ) projectFiles3 = glob.glob( os.path.join(projectDir, '*.markdown') )
142 python  glob 


7
Scorri tutti i file con un'estensione specifica
for i in $(ls);do if [ $i = '*.java' ];then echo "I do something with the file $i" fi done Voglio scorrere ogni file nella cartella corrente e controllare se corrisponde a un'estensione specifica. Il codice sopra non funziona, sai perché?
109 bash  file  glob 

2
gulp globbing- come guardare tutto sotto la directory
Questa è una domanda piuttosto stupida, ma non sono riuscito a trovare una risposta soddisfacente: come faccio a utilizzare gulp globbing per selezionare tutti i file in tutte le sottodirectory sotto una determinata directory? Ho provato: './src/less' './src/less/' './src/less/*' Nessuno di loro sembra funzionare.
108 glob  gulp 


10
glob esclude pattern
Ho una directory con un gruppo di file all'interno: eee2314, asd3442... e eph. Voglio escludere tutti i file che iniziano ephcon la globfunzione. Come posso farlo?
105 python  glob 

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.